Output e2826091dbd5f21fc3f127cbef1b4ac938ebaf07a71df65e37bccf1a1fe07b65:1

value
4249489070
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c269fc9ba1cc7de6ba6d41410654b49f2bc9cc1 OP_EQUALVERIFY OP_CHECKSIG
address
152T16Wjnv1smJBJFDABdKRNVYrj8jsUqj
transaction
e2826091dbd5f21fc3f127cbef1b4ac938ebaf07a71df65e37bccf1a1fe07b65
confirmations
423105
spent
true